5. Using Memory Function
5.2 Viewing the Average Reading
Your monitor can calculate an average reading based on the latest 2
or 3 readings taken within the most recent 10 minute timeframe.
1. Select your user ID.
2. When your monitor is off, press and hold the
button for more than 3 seconds.
The “ ” symbol flashes.
Note
If there are only 2 readings in the
memory for that period, the average
will be based on these 2 readings.
If the average reading is high (refer to
sub-section 1.3), the “ ” symbol
appears.

Omron 10 Series Specifications

General IconGeneral
DisplayLCD
TechnologyAdvanced Accuracy
Bluetooth ConnectivityYes
Irregular Heartbeat DetectionYes
Hypertension IndicatorYes
Pressure Range0 to 299 mmHg
Pulse Rate Range40 to 180 beats/min
Average ReadingYes
Power Source4 AA batteries or AC adapter
Cuff SizeComFit Cuff (fits arms 9 to 17 inches in circumference)
Memory Storage200 readings (100 readings each for 2 users)
WeightApprox. 400g (without batteries)
